Gamma ray transmission for hydraulic conductivity measurement of undisturbed soil columns BABT
Moreira,Anderson Camargo; Portezan Filho,Otávio; Cavalcante,Fábio Henrique Moraes; Coimbra,Melayne Martins; Appoloni,Carlos Roberto.
This work had the objective to determine the Hydraulic Conductivity K(theta) function for different depth levels z, of columns of undisturbed soil, using the gamma ray transmission technique applied to the Sisson method. The results indicated a growing behavior for K(theta) and a homogeneous soil density, both in relation to the increase of the depth. The methodology of gamma ray transmission showed satisfactory results on the determination of the hydraulic conductivity in columns of undisturbed soil, besides being very reliable and a nondestructive method.

Soil hydraulic conductivily measurement on a sloping field AGRIAMBI
Timm,Luís Carlos; Oliveira,Julio Cesar Martins de; Tominaga,Tânia Toyomi; Cássaro,Fábio Augusto Meira; Reichardt,Klaus; Bacchi,Osny Oliveira Santos.
A field methodology is presented for the measurement of the soil hydraulic conductivity in a sloping field, minimizing the leveling soil movement before water pounding and redistribution. The assurance of vertical flow only is performed through soil water potential isolines. The hydraulic conductivity was determined by the instantaneous profile method. Results for the nine neutron probe access tubes indicate that one single K(theta) relation is sufficient to represent the experimental site.
